In addition to traditional rehabilitation equipment, there are innovative devices designed to enhance recovery and rehabilitation. For example, exoskeletons and robotic gait trainers represent the cutting edge of mobility technology. These devices assist users in walking and can significantly improve physical therapy outcomes. By providing support during walking, they help retrain muscles, improve coordination, and offer users a sense of empowerment and accomplishment.
Patient needs vary dramatically depending on their medical conditions, mobility levels, and treatment plans. Assess whether the patient requires special features, such as side rails for safety, pressure-relief mattresses to prevent bedsores, or adjustable height for easy access by caregivers. Additionally, consider the patient's mobility; those who are less mobile may benefit from beds with advanced features like manual or electric controls for ease of use.

One of the key advantages of portable electric wheelchairs is their lightweight design. Constructed from advanced materials such as aluminum and carbon fiber, these wheelchairs are easier to transport than their conventional counterparts. Many models can be conveniently folded up, making them perfect for users who frequently travel or need to navigate tight spaces. This portability means individuals can take their wheelchairs in cars, airplanes, or even on public transportation, enabling a level of spontaneity that was once difficult to achieve.

Hygiene is paramount when it comes to using public restrooms, and portable adult potties are often designed with this in mind. Many models come equipped with features such as built-in hand sanitizers, disposable liners, and easy-to-clean surfaces. This focus on hygiene is critical, particularly for individuals who may be more susceptible to infections and illnesses.

Another critical factor to consider is usability. Elderly users often prefer simple, intuitive designs that do not complicate the toileting process. Some commode seats feature built-in handles or grab bars that provide extra stability. This can be especially beneficial for those who may experience dizziness or weakness. Moreover, many commode seats are designed to fit a variety of toilet shapes and sizes, making it easier for families to find the right fit for their needs.
